Breaking: Greenville Police Arrest Man on Multiple Drug Charges During Routine Stop

A Greenville man has been arrested on multiple drug charges following a traffic stop that concluded a three-month investigation. The Pitt County Sheriff’s Office reported that 31-year-old Travis McCormick, Jr. was taken into custody just before 2 p.m. after being pulled over on South Memorial Drive at Arlington Boulevard.

During the traffic stop, deputies discovered trafficking amounts of fentanyl, felony amounts of cocaine, Xanax, marijuana, and a large sum of cash. Authorities stated that the stop was the result of an extensive investigation into drug-related activities in the area.

McCormick has been charged with multiple offenses, including five counts of trafficking opium, possession of a controlled substance with the intent to manufacture, sell, or deliver heroin, and possession of a controlled substance with the intent to manufacture, sell, or deliver marijuana. He also faces five counts of maintaining a vehicle or dwelling for drug-related activities.

Following his arrest, McCormick was taken to the Pitt County Jail. While in custody, he was found to be in possession of fentanyl, leading to an additional charge of possession of controlled substances on jail premises.

Authorities have set McCormick’s bond at $4,501,920 secured, and he remains in jail as the investigation continues. The Pitt County Sheriff’s Office emphasized its commitment to combating drug-related crimes and urged the community to report any suspicious activities.
